I had a working copy of KDE Neon 5.7 on my Thinkpad X220 (i5-2410m 16GB ram)

I upgraded the system using apt-get.  The screen went blank.  now whenever I try to start the computer, I get the KDE Neon 5.8 splash screen, but nothing after that.  The system is not hung - keys do not respond, but if I press the power button or CTRL-ALT-DEL combination (maybe just any key?) the splash screen returns and the system reboots.
